29.01.2013 Views

Anais do IHC'2001 - Departamento de Informática e Estatística - UFSC

Anais do IHC'2001 - Departamento de Informática e Estatística - UFSC

Anais do IHC'2001 - Departamento de Informática e Estatística - UFSC

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ong>Anais</strong> <strong>do</strong> IHC’2001 - IV Workshop sobre Fatores Humanos em Sistemas Computacionais 51<br />

3. Especificação <strong>de</strong> Interfaces Web: Um Exemplo<br />

Vários mo<strong>de</strong>los para especificação <strong>de</strong> interfaces multimídia e baseada em hipertexto têm<br />

si<strong>do</strong> propostos nos últimos anos, tais como XHMBS [14], OOHDM [19], HMD [5],<br />

statecharts [9, 22] e re<strong>de</strong>s <strong>de</strong> Petri [20]. Neste trabalho, optou-se pela notação<br />

StateWebCharts [23], que é uma extensão <strong>de</strong> Statechart [7] concebida especificamente para<br />

mo<strong>de</strong>lar interfaces Web. Entre outros recursos, esta notação representa visualmente os<br />

limites da aplicação mo<strong>de</strong>lada, controle <strong>de</strong> ações sobre a interface (usuário ou sistema),<br />

representação <strong>de</strong> distribuição cliente/servi<strong>do</strong>r e composição visual da aplicação [23]. Estas<br />

características não são consi<strong>de</strong>radas nos mo<strong>de</strong>los menciona<strong>do</strong>s e, por consi<strong>de</strong>rá-las<br />

importantes, optou-se por StateWebCharts.<br />

Não é objetivo <strong>de</strong>ste trabalho <strong>de</strong>screver toda a notação StateWebcharts, por isto, apenas os<br />

conceitos importantes para a discussão sobre a avaliação <strong>de</strong> usabilida<strong>de</strong> serão apresenta<strong>do</strong>s.<br />

Como exemplo, é apresenta<strong>do</strong> uma mo<strong>de</strong>lagem parcial <strong>do</strong> site Web HIBAM: HIdrologia<br />

da Bacia AMazônica. O objetivo <strong>do</strong> site, que ainda está em <strong>de</strong>senvolvimento, é<br />

disponibilizar os resulta<strong>do</strong>s das pesquisas realizadas em cooperação Brasil-França neste<br />

tema durante a última década.<br />

Antes <strong>de</strong> especificar a navegação com StateWebCharts, foi construída uma <strong>de</strong>scrição<br />

hierárquica das informações <strong>do</strong> site, conforme figura 2. Observe que este mo<strong>de</strong>lo <strong>de</strong>screve<br />

instâncias (e não classes) <strong>de</strong> informações contidas no site e que, <strong>de</strong>vi<strong>do</strong> ao gran<strong>de</strong> número<br />

<strong>de</strong> ramificações da árvore hierárquica, vários ramos não são <strong>de</strong>talha<strong>do</strong>s. Os objetivos <strong>de</strong>sta<br />

representação hierárquica são: a) criar uma lista completa das informações que fazem parte<br />

<strong>do</strong> site; e, b) organizar as informações em grupos <strong>de</strong> forma coerente ao <strong>do</strong>mínio da<br />

informação.<br />

� Apresentação (home)<br />

� Campanhas ( <strong>de</strong> 1994 – 2000)<br />

� Amazonas_94<br />

� Amazonas_94<br />

� Estações visitadas<br />

� Negro_95<br />

� Ma<strong>de</strong>ira_95<br />

� Solimoes_95<br />

� Negro_96<br />

� Purus_96<br />

� Beni_96<br />

� Branco_96<br />

� Solimoes_97<br />

� Encontro_97<br />

� Xingu_97<br />

� Humboldt LEGENDA:� Ramo mostran<strong>do</strong> subdivisões<br />

� Estações �Ramo com subdivisões sem <strong>de</strong>talhes<br />

� Meto<strong>do</strong>logia �Ramo sem subdivisões<br />

� Lista <strong>de</strong> pessoas para contatos<br />

� Documentos publica<strong>do</strong>s (artigos, relatórios, etc.)<br />

� Links para outros projetos e sites<br />

� FAQ<br />

� Consulta a base <strong>de</strong> da<strong>do</strong>s <strong>do</strong> HIBAM<br />

Figura 2. Mo<strong>de</strong>lo hierárquico <strong>de</strong> informações HIBAM.<br />

Os itens representa<strong>do</strong>s na figura 2 foram utiliza<strong>do</strong>s para construir a especificação da<br />

navegação com StateWebCharts. A <strong>de</strong>scrição hierárquica <strong>do</strong> site po<strong>de</strong> sugerir a criação <strong>de</strong><br />

<strong>do</strong>cumentos <strong>do</strong> site, porém, a transposição da hierarquia lógica para <strong>do</strong>cumentos físicos

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!